Wisconsin Physicians Service (WPS) Health Solution Therapists
Wisconsin Physicians Service Insurance Corporation has served the people of Wisconsin for more than 65 years. WPS is a not-for-profit health insurer, offering affordable individual health insurance, family health insurance, high-deductible health plans, and short-term health insurance, as well as flexible and affordable group plans and cost-effective benefit plan administration for businesses.
